The JP1081B is a common, low-cost USB to Ethernet adapter that often identifies as a generic "USB 2.0 10/100M Ethernet Adapter". It typically uses either a Davicom DM9601/DM9621A chipset or a Corechip SR9700/SR9800 chipset. Driver & Installation Guide

If your device is not automatically recognized, you can follow these steps to install the driver manually:

Automatic Detection: On modern systems like Windows 10/11, these adapters are often plug-and-play. Windows may automatically download the necessary drivers through Windows Update. Manual Installation (Windows): Open Device Manager by right-clicking the Start button.

Find the adapter (likely listed as an "Unknown Device" or "USB 2.0 10/100M Ethernet Adapter").

Right-click it and select Update Driver > Browse my computer for drivers.

Point it to the folder containing your downloaded drivers or search automatically. MacOS & Linux:

For MacOS, specific community-developed drivers like USBCDCEthernet on GitHub are often used to fix issues with random MAC addresses or missing native support.

On Linux/Raspberry Pi, these devices are typically supported by the dm9601 or sr9700 kernel modules. Troubleshooting Wholesale Full Speed Jp1081b Lan Adapter Dual Port Design

The JP1081B USB LAN driver (often identified as a "JP1081 USB 2.0 to Fast Ethernet Adapter") is typically used for budget USB-to-Ethernet adapters based on the Corechip RD9700 or Davicom DM9601 chipsets. jp1081b usb lan driver 21

Below is a technical guide formatted for a paper or instructional report. Technical Brief: JP1081B USB 2.0 Fast Ethernet Adapter 1. Device Identification

The JP1081B is a generic branding for a low-cost network adapter. In Windows Device Manager, it is most frequently identified by the following hardware IDs: Hardware ID: USB\VID_0FE6&PID_9700 Alternate ID: USB\VID_0A46&PID_9601 (Davicom-based) Compatible Chipset: Corechip RD9700 / Davicom DM9601. 2. Driver Requirements and Compatibility

Operating Systems: Support includes Windows 7, 8, 10, and 11 (32-bit and 64-bit).

Driver Version: Commonly referred to as version 1.0.921.0 (released circa 2010-09-21).

Performance: These adapters are "Fast Ethernet," meaning they are capped at 10/100 Mbps. They will not provide Gigabit speeds even if plugged into a USB 3.0 port. 3. Installation Procedures

Because many of these devices are "Plug and Play," Windows 10/11 may attempt to install them automatically. If the device fails to work, follow these manual steps:

Access Device Manager: Right-click the Start button and select Device Manager.

Locate the Device: Look for "Generic USB Hub" or "Unknown Device" with a yellow exclamation mark. Update Driver: Right-click the device and select Update driver. Choose "Browse my computer for drivers." The JP1081B is a common, low-cost USB to

Select "Let me pick from a list of available drivers on my computer." Manual Selection:

Click "Have Disk..." and point to the extracted driver folder containing the .inf file. Select the RD9700 or JP1081 model from the list. 4. Troubleshooting Common Issues

"Device Not Recognized": Ensure the adapter is plugged into a USB 2.0 port if possible, as some older JP1081B controllers have compatibility issues with newer USB 3.0/3.1 controllers.

Slow Speeds: Verify the Ethernet cable is at least Cat5e. Note that these chips often struggle to exceed 50-60 Mbps in real-world testing due to the overhead of the RD9700 chipset.

Driver Signature Enforcement: On Windows 10/11, you may need to disable Driver Signature Enforcement temporarily if the driver is "unsigned." 5. Sourcing the Driver
